*SOLD* 2019 CZ-USA 75 B 9mm Stainless 4.6" *HEAD-TURNING DISCONTINUED MODEL*
Bryant Ridge's Analysis:
Discontinued in 2019, the CZ 75 B Stainless was the first stainless steel firearm to bear the CZ name. Functionally identical to the original CZ 75 B, the stainless version offers enhanced corrosion resistance, with the only notable differences being the inclusion of an ambidextrous manual safety and rubber grips. Many also argue that the stainless steel construction improves the pistol’s appearance. The CZ 75 B is widely regarded as one of the most trusted pistols in the world, used by more governments, military forces, police, and security agencies than any other handgun. Designed in 1975, the CZ 75 is often considered the perfect pistol, offering all-steel construction (except for alloy-framed compacts), high-capacity double-column magazines, hammer-forged barrels, ergonomic grips and controls, and unparalleled accuracy. Its slide-in-frame design enhances recoil control, while the three-dot sighting system (with optional Tritium night sights) ensures quick target acquisition. The CZ 75 features smooth double-action and crisp single-action triggers, a firing pin block safety, and a long service life thanks to its advanced design and superior materials.
